Liveblogging…Am curretnly sitting in the skybox at Rutgers University Stadium as the Dalai Lama gives a talk… “Peace, War & Reconciliation”. He is speaking about how people feel hate and anger is 90 percent mental perception and not reality. A high percentage of peoples ideas of anger and hate are exaggerated. And, we all lose our tempter, feel anger… “When I speak, say harsh words, dominated by anger, afterwords I feel shy about speaking to that person I was angry at, so I realize that anger dominated my mind, and thus my mind was not functioning properly. Negative emotion always hidees reality. The action that is carried by these negative emotions thus is not correct.” [...]

“We are social animals, no matter how powerful one single person is, without a community that person can not survive. I am part of a community, and in order to succeed, I have to take into account other communities beyond my own. Otherwise, I do not succeed. Compassion and attachment come into play… [...]

“Compassion, sense of closeness is unbiased… attachment is biased. Compassion is closeness.”

“Compassion can extend to your enemy. Attachment can not. One must extend compassion to ones enemies and those who hate.”

“Compassion brings us all together, and that is based in mutual respect. It opens our inner door. So, dealing with people is then not stressful. Distrust is reduced. Suspicion is reduced. Self centeredness is reduced.”

“In your heart, open your heart, extend your hand, then comes the possibility to find change and end suspicion. Smile.”
